Frequently Asked Questions about Homestead
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Homestead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Homestead ranges from $547 to $2,402 with an average monthly rent of $1,753.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Homestead c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Homestead range from $652 to $2,826.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,231.
How expensive are Homestead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 106 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Homestead on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$742 to $3,640 - averaging $2,592 for the location.
